Gerald Commerford

The campus community mourns the passing of Gerald Commerford, 79, who died Saturday, March 14. Gerry retired after more than 40 years of service to Bucknell as the associate dean of students.  Gerry’s impact at Bucknell was remarkable and lasting. He always prioritized students, and as alums they consistently shared stories about how he touched and changed their lives. During his tenure, Gerry received numerous awards for his dedication and attention to a student-centered philosophy. In honor of his lasting impact, Bucknell established the Gerald W.
